Output e309bdc23781b885aed44dc97ed8dbb3ca5569238f90000233c92b4a15e94702:23

value
76259
script pubkey
OP_0 OP_PUSHBYTES_20 d21665345aca6842b99bf6abdfb3587e29b87abd
address
bc1q6gtx2dz6ef5y9wvm764alv6c0c5ms74a3ehmsd
transaction
e309bdc23781b885aed44dc97ed8dbb3ca5569238f90000233c92b4a15e94702
confirmations
69113
spent
true